[amazon-ec2] Amazon EC2 인스턴스를 t1.micro에서 large로 안전하게 업그레이드하는 방법은 무엇입니까? [닫은]

Amazon EC2 마이크로 인스턴스 (t1.micro)가 있습니다. 이 인스턴스를 크게 업그레이드하고 싶습니다. 이것이 우리의 프로덕션 환경이므로이를 위해 가장 위험이없는 최선의 방법은 무엇입니까?

이를 수행하기위한 단계별 가이드가 있습니까?



답변

내 경험상 내가하는 방식은 현재 이미지의 스냅 샷을 만든 다음 완료되면 새 인스턴스를 시작할 때 옵션으로 볼 수 있습니다. 그 시점에서 간단히 큰 인스턴스로 시작하십시오.

이 솔루션은 새로운 서버가 가동되고 실행 된 후에 만 ​​서버를 오프라인으로 가져 오기 때문에 다운 타임 (예 : 프로덕션 서버)을 원하지 않는 경우 접근 방식입니다 (이 방법을 사용하여 클러스터에 새 시스템을 추가하는 데 사용함). 새 기계 만 추가). 가동 중지 시간이 허용 가능한 경우 Marcel Castilho의 답변을 참조하십시오.


답변

AWS Management Console 사용 :

  • 인스턴스를 마우스 오른쪽 버튼으로 클릭
    • 인스턴스 수명주기> 중지
    • 기다림…
    • 인스턴스 관리> 인스턴스 유형 변경

답변

AWS Management Console 사용

  • “볼륨”으로 이동하여 인스턴스 볼륨의 스냅 샷을 생성하십시오.
  • “스냅 샷”으로 이동하여 “스냅 샷에서 이미지 생성”을 선택하십시오.
  • “AMI”로 이동하여 “인스턴스 시작”을 선택하고 “인스턴스 유형”등을 선택하십시오.

답변

ElasticFox가 아닌 AWS EC2 콘솔을 사용하십시오.

첫 번째 방법 :

  • 인스턴스의 새 AMI 생성
  • 시작

대체 방법 :

  • 디스크 의 스냅 샷 만들기
  • 동일한 AMI 유형 으로 큰 EBS 인스턴스시작합니다 (이 시점에서 디스크에는이 AMI가 생성 될 때 존재했던 데이터가 포함되어 있으며 최신 변경 사항은 포함되지 않습니다)
  • 완전히 부팅되면 새 인스턴스를 중지하십시오
  • 중지 된 인스턴스에서 루트 볼륨분리하십시오.
  • 새 인스턴스의 동일한 가용 영역에서 생성 된 스냅 샷에서 가상 디스크 생성
  • 루트 볼륨을 / dev / sda1에 연결하십시오
  • 새 인스턴스를 다시 시작 하십시오.

답변

큰 인스턴스에서 AMI-> 부팅 AMI를 만듭니다.

추가 정보 http://docs.amazonwebservices.com/AmazonEC2/gsg/2006-06-26/creating-an-image.html

aws.amazon.com의 관리 콘솔에서도이 모든 작업을 수행 할 수 있습니다.


답변